The New Roof Installation Process

A professional new roof installation in Mansfield City typically follows a structured process designed to ensure quality, durability, and safety. Local roofing professionals in areas like Mansfield City, Storrs, and surrounding towns are experienced with the specific challenges presented by the regional climate and common housing styles found here, from classic colonial homes to more contemporary structures.

Initial Consultation and Inspection

The process begins with an in-depth consultation and inspection. A qualified roofing contractor will visit your property to assess the current condition of your roof. This inspection focuses on identifying any underlying issues, such as water damage, rot in the decking, or structural problems, which need to be addressed before the new installation can begin. They will also discuss material options, style preferences, and answer any questions you may have.

Material Selection

Choosing the right materials is a critical step in a new roof installation in Mansfield City. Local contractors are well-versed in the performance of various roofing materials under Connecticut’s weather conditions.

  • Asphalt Shingles: The most common and cost-effective option, asphalt shingles offer good durability and a wide range of styles and colors. Architectural shingles, a popular upgrade, provide greater dimension and longevity.
  • Metal Roofing: Known for its exceptional durability, longevity, and resistance to harsh weather, metal roofs are becoming increasingly popular in areas like Mansfield City. They can withstand heavy snow loads and high winds.
  • Wood Shakes and Shingles: Offering a natural, rustic aesthetic, these are less common in some areas due to maintenance and fire concerns but can be suitable for certain architectural styles.
  • Slate or Tile: Premium options offering unparalleled beauty and longevity, though they are heavier and more expensive, requiring specialized installation.

Site Preparation and Old Roof Removal

Before the new materials are installed, the work area will be carefully prepared. This includes laying down protective tarps to safeguard landscaping and the exterior of your home. The existing roofing materials, including shingles, underlayment, and flashing, are then completely removed and disposed of responsibly. This ensures a clean and solid base for the new roof.

Decking Inspection and Repair

Once the old roof is removed, the underlying roof decking (usually plywood or OSB) is thoroughly inspected. This plywood layer is the foundation of your roof. Any signs of rot, water damage, or structural weakness are addressed. Damaged sections are repaired or replaced to create a sound surface for the new roofing system.

Installation of Underlayment and Ice and Water Shield

A critical layer of protection, the underlayment, is installed over the decking. This provides an extra barrier against moisture. In Mansfield City and other parts of Connecticut, the installation of an ice and water shield is highly recommended, particularly along eaves, valleys, and around penetrations like chimneys and vents. This specialized membrane prevents ice dams from forming and stops water from leaking into the home during heavy snowmelt or rainstorms.

New Roof Installation

The new roofing material is then meticulously installed according to manufacturer specifications and local building codes. This includes carefully applying each shingle or metal panel, installing flashing around all roof penetrations and edges to prevent leaks, and ensuring proper ventilation. Proper ventilation is key in Mansfield City to prevent moisture buildup and regulate attic temperature, which can save on energy costs.

Final Inspection and Cleanup

Upon completion of the installation, the contractor will conduct a final, thorough inspection to ensure the roof has been installed correctly and meets all quality standards. The work area is then meticulously cleaned, with all debris, nails, and old materials removed, leaving your property tidy and secure.

Frequently Asked Questions about New Roof Installation in Mansfield City

What common roofing issues should I look for in Mansfield City’s climate?

In Mansfield City, you should be aware of issues stemming from freeze-thaw cycles that can damage shingles, ice dams forming on lower-pitched roofs due to prolonged cold, and potential wind damage from storms. Look for curling or missing shingles, sagging areas, or damp spots in your attic.

How long does a new roof installation typically take in Mansfield City?

The duration of a new roof installation depends on the size and complexity of the roof, as well as the materials chosen. For a standard residential home in Mansfield City, the process usually takes between one and three days to complete.

What is the average lifespan of different roofing materials in Connecticut’s weather?

Asphalt shingles typically last 20-30 years. Metal roofs can last 40-70 years. High-quality architectural shingles may offer a slightly longer lifespan than traditional three-tab shingles. These estimates are based on proper installation and regional maintenance, considering Connecticut’s variable weather patterns.

Storm Risk & Climate Factors — Mansfield City, Connecticut

The county surrounding Mansfield City averages 1.1 significant hail events per year (hail diameter ≥ 1"). High-wind events average 7.5 per year. Source: NOAA National Centers for Environmental Information, Storm Events Database, 2014–2023.

With 5,955 annual heating degree days, Mansfield City is in a climate where ice dams are a real seasonal hazard — attic heat escapes through the roof deck, melts snow, and the meltwater refreezes at the cold eaves, backing up under shingles and causing interior moisture damage. Proper attic insulation, air sealing, and ice-and-water shield at the eaves are the primary defenses. Source: Open-Meteo ERA5 Climate Reanalysis, 2014–2023 average.

What New Roof Installation Involves

Existing materials are stripped to the decking, which is inspected and renailed or replaced as needed; synthetic underlayment, drip edge, and ice-and-water shield at eaves are installed first; then shingles are laid in overlapping courses from the eave up to the ridge cap

Will homeowners insurance cover New Roof Installation in Mansfield City?

Insurance typically covers sudden storm damage — hail, wind, and falling trees — but not gradual wear or pre-existing deterioration. Document all damage with photos immediately after a storm and contact your insurer before any repair work begins.

Can I do New Roof Installation myself?

Not realistic as a DIY — a full reroof requires a crew, shingle lifts, dumpster coordination, and permit knowledge; errors in underlayment or flashing create leak paths that may not show for months
